Course Overview
The HNC Modern Manufacturing Engineering provides an applied introduction to the engineering principles, technologies and professional practices used within contemporary manufacturing.
You will explore how products and components are designed, produced, measured and improved. The course develops knowledge of engineering mathematics and science alongside production engineering, quality improvement and computer-aided design and manufacture.
It is suitable for people seeking to develop higher-level technical knowledge for manufacturing employment, career progression or further study at HND level.
What will I learn?
You will develop your ability to: • apply engineering mathematics, simulation, science and data analysis to practical manufacturing problems; • interpret engineering requirements and contribute to the design and development of technical solutions; • understand production methods, manufacturing processes and the factors affecting productivity; • use quality and process-improvement methods to investigate performance and recommend improvements; • create and interpret three-dimensional engineering models and manufacturing information; • consider safety, cost, quality, sustainability and professional responsibilities when making engineering decisions; and • communicate technical information clearly through written, oral, graphical and digital formats.
The approved modules are:
Level 4 modules • Introduction to Engineering Mathematics and Simulation • Engineering Science and Data Analysis • Project Design & Build • Production Engineering • Quality & Process Improvement • Introduction to 3D Computer Aided Design and Manufacture
How is the course delivered?
This course is delivered part-time over 18 months through face-to-face teaching at Accrington or Nelson Campus, depending on the confirmed course offering. Timetabled teaching is normally spread across two days. Delivery includes lectures, workshops, practical activities, computer-based sessions, tutorials, design tasks and guided independent study.
How will my learning be assessed?
Assessment is through a varied range of methods appropriate to manufacturing engineering. These may include technical reports, practical work, portfolios, design and CAD activities, presentations, project work, tests and examinations. You will also receive formative feedback through workshops, tutorials and discussion of developing work before final submission.

Potential Careers
The course can support progression in manufacturing and production environments. Depending on your previous experience and individual employer requirements, relevant roles may include:
• manufacturing or production engineering technician; • quality or process-improvement technician; • CAD/CAM technician; • engineering manufacturing technician; • production planning or technical support role; • maintenance or operations support technician.
Completion does not guarantee entry to a particular job. Employers may require additional experience, training, certification or evidence of occupational competence.
